2.3 Reading & Understanding Pesticide Labels

[!NOTE] The Central Axiom of Pesticide Law: "The Label is the Law." This fundamental legal principle governs every aspect of chemical pest management. The pesticide label is not a set of generic recommendations or promotional suggestions; it is a legally binding federal and state regulatory document reviewed, approved, and registered by the United States Environmental Protection Agency (EPA) under FIFRA and the Kentucky Department of Agriculture under KRS Chapter 217B.

Every professional pesticide applicator must possess absolute fluency in navigating, interpreting, and applying the instructions set forth on pesticide container labels. Applying a product in a manner inconsistent with its labeling violates both federal and state statutes, exposing the applicator to civil fines, license revocation, and civil liability for resulting environmental damage or human injury. Mastering label anatomy, deciphering acute toxicity signal words, and strictly obeying re-entry and harvest intervals are indispensable competencies for certified applicators.


The Legal Primacy of the Label: FIFRA Section 12(a)(2)(G)

Under Section 12(a)(2)(G) of the Federal Insecticide, Fungicide, and Rodenticide Act (FIFRA), Congress codified the universal legal standard:

"It shall be unlawful for any person to use any registered pesticide in a manner inconsistent with its labeling."\text{"It shall be unlawful for any person to use any registered pesticide in a manner inconsistent with its labeling."}

This statutory provision is incorporated directly into Kentucky law under KRS 217B. Examples of illegal, off-label pesticide usage include:

  • Applying to an agricultural crop, commodity, animal, or structural site not expressly authorized in the Directions for Use.
  • Exceeding the maximum allowable application rate per acre or per application season.
  • Violating mandatory Personal Protective Equipment (PPE) requirements.
  • Applying during prohibited weather conditions (e.g., wind speeds exceeding label limits or during thermal inversions).
  • Ignoring mandatory buffer zones around aquatic resources, sinkholes, or sensitive residential zones.
  • Permitting agricultural workers to enter treated fields prior to the expiration of the Restricted-Entry Interval (REI) without required protective gear.

Statutory Exceptions under FIFRA Section 2(ee)

To prevent rigid interpretations that would impair sound agricultural practices, Congress established narrow, legally permissible exceptions under FIFRA Section 2(ee). An application is NOT considered a violation of the label if an applicator:

  1. Applies at a Lower Dosage, Concentration, or Frequency: Applying less chemical than the maximum labeled rate is legally permissible, provided the label does not explicitly state "Do not apply at rates below the specified dosage" (a common restriction on certain resistance-managed fungicides and nematicides).
  2. Applies Against an Unlisted Target Pest on a Listed Crop/Site: If an applicator is treating corn against an emerging insect species not explicitly mentioned in the pest list, the application is legal provided that corn is an approved crop on the label and all other labeled rates, timings, and restrictions are followed.
  3. Employs Any Unprohibited Application Method: Utilizing an unmentioned mechanical application method (such as a ground boom instead of chemigation) is permissible, unless the label specifically prohibits that method (e.g., "Do not apply by aircraft" or "For ground boom application only").
  4. Mixes with Other Pesticides or Fertilizers: Tank-mixing multiple labeled products or liquid fertilizers is allowed, provided the label does not explicitly prohibit the mixture and the products are physically and chemically compatible.

Key Components of a Pesticide Label

Every pesticide label follows a standardized regulatory structure mandated by EPA regulations (40 CFR Part 156):

  • Trade / Brand Name: The commercial brand name under which the product is marketed by the chemical registrant (e.g., Roundup PRO®, Warrior II®, Bravo Weather Stik®). The brand name is chosen for commercial marketing and often contains numbers indicating formulation strength.
  • Common Name: The universally recognized, non-proprietary chemical name assigned to the active ingredient by official bodies such as ANSI or ISO (e.g., glyphosate, lambda-cyhalothrin, chlorothalonil). Because multiple manufacturers sell the same chemical under competing trade names, the common name is the true identifier of the active compound.
  • Chemical Name: The complex, precise molecular formula name defined by IUPAC or Chemical Abstracts Service (CAS) nomenclature (e.g., N-(phosphonomethyl)glycine for glyphosate).
  • Ingredient Statement: A mandatory breakdown disclosing the percentage by weight (or volume) of each Active Ingredient (AI) alongside the aggregate percentage of Inert / Other Ingredients (solvents, emulsifiers, surfactants, carriers). The total must always equal 100.0%.
  • Net Contents: The total volume (gallons, quarts, fluid ounces) or dry weight (pounds, ounces, kilograms) of chemical packaged inside the container.

EPA Registration Number vs. EPA Establishment Number

A critical distinction on every commercial exam involves differentiating between the two EPA identification numbers printed on every pesticide container:

+--------------------------------------------------------------------------------+
|                    EPA Product Identification Numbers                          |
+--------------------------------------------------------------------------------+
| EPA Reg. No. 100-722-5544   <-- EPA Registration Number (Product Identity)     |
|     [100] = Chemical Registrant / Manufacturer (e.g., Syngenta)                |
|     [722] = Specific Formulated Product Approval                               |
|    [5544] = Supplemental Distributor Code (present on sub-registered products) |
|                                                                                |
| EPA Est. No. 100-NC-001     <-- EPA Establishment Number (Manufacturing Plant) |
|     [100] = Company Identifier                                                 |
|      [NC] = Two-Letter State Code (North Carolina Facility)                    |
|     [001] = Specific Physical Packaging / Bottling Plant Identifier           |
+--------------------------------------------------------------------------------+

[!IMPORTANT] The High-Yield Distinctions:

  • EPA Registration Number (EPA Reg. No.): Uniquely identifies the chemical manufacturer and the specific formulated product approved by the EPA. It must be entered on every Kentucky application log.
  • EPA Establishment Number (EPA Est. No.): Identifies the physical manufacturing facility or packaging plant where that specific container was formulated, bottled, or repacked. It changes depending on which regional plant packaged the batch and does NOT identify product formulation.

Signal Words, Toxicity Categories, and Hazard Symbols

The EPA assigns an acute toxicity Signal Word to every registered pesticide product based on comprehensive laboratory toxicological screening across four exposure pathways: acute oral, acute dermal, acute inhalation, and primary eye/skin irritation.

+--------------------------------------------------------------------------------+
|                      EPA Toxicity Categories & Signal Words                    |
+--------------------------------------------------------------------------------+
| Category I   : DANGER - POISON (with Skull & Crossbones) | Highly Toxic Systemic|
| Category I   : DANGER (alone, without skull & bones)     | Highly Corrosive    |
| Category II  : WARNING                                   | Moderately Toxic    |
| Category III : CAUTION                                   | Slightly Toxic      |
| Category IV  : CAUTION (or no signal word required)      | Practically Non-Toxic|
+--------------------------------------------------------------------------------+

Detailed Analysis of Signal Words

  1. DANGER - POISON with Skull and Crossbones Symbol:
    • Toxicity Tier: Category I (Extremely Toxic / Fatal).
    • Lethal Dose ($LD_{50}$): Acute oral $LD_{50}$ from $0\text{ to }50\text{ mg/kg}$. A microscopic taste to a single teaspoon can kill an adult human.
    • Hazard Profile: Extreme acute systemic lethality. The label must feature the word POISON printed in bold red letters alongside the universal skull and crossbones icon.
  2. DANGER (Without Skull and Crossbones):
    • Toxicity Tier: Category I (Severe Localized Hazard / Corrosive).
    • Hazard Profile: Represents severe localized tissue destruction rather than extreme oral systemic lethality. Specifically indicates corrosive properties causing irreversible eye damage (blindness) or severe skin necrosis.
  3. WARNING:
    • Toxicity Tier: Category II (Moderately Toxic).
    • Lethal Dose ($LD_{50}$): Acute oral $LD_{50}$ from $50\text{ to }500\text{ mg/kg}$. A lethal oral dose for an average adult ranges from one teaspoon to two tablespoons.
    • Hazard Profile: Moderate systemic toxicity, or reversible but significant corneal eye opacity or severe skin irritation persisting up to 7 days.
  4. CAUTION:
    • Toxicity Tier: Category III (Slightly Toxic, oral $LD_{50}$ between $500\text{ and }5,000\text{ mg/kg}$) and Category IV (Practically Non-Toxic, oral $LD_{50} > 5,000\text{ mg/kg}$).
    • Hazard Profile: Slight systemic toxicity or mild, transient skin/eye irritation.

Master Signal Word Comparison Table

Signal WordToxicity CategoryApproximate Lethal Oral Dose (Adult)Oral $LD_{50}$ RangePrimary Hazard Profile
DANGER - POISON (Skull & Crossbones)Category IA few drops to 1 teaspoon$0 - 50\text{ mg/kg}$Acute systemic lethality; immediate poisoning hazard
DANGER (Alone)Category I1 teaspoon to 1 ounceCorrosive (Variable)Permanent irreversible eye damage; severe skin burns
WARNINGCategory II1 teaspoon to 2 tablespoons$50 - 500\text{ mg/kg}$Moderate systemic toxicity; corneal irritation
CAUTIONCategory III1 ounce to 1 pint$500 - 5,000\text{ mg/kg}$Slight systemic toxicity; minor skin/eye irritation
CAUTION / NoneCategory IVOver 1 pint (over 2 pounds)$> 5,000\text{ mg/kg}$Practically non-toxic; minimal irritation

Precautionary Statements and Emergency First Aid

Precautionary statements provide actionable directives designed to protect human handlers, domestic animals, and non-target environments:

  • Hazards to Humans and Domestic Animals: Identifies specific routes of occupational vulnerability (e.g., "Fatal if absorbed through skin. Causes moderate eye irritation. Prolonged or frequently repeated skin contact may cause allergic reactions in some individuals").
  • Personal Protective Equipment (PPE) Requirements: Identifies the mandatory protective barrier gear required for handlers during mixing, loading, application, and equipment cleaning (e.g., chemical-resistant gloves made of barrier laminate or butyl rubber, protective eyewear, NIOSH-approved particulate respirators, and chemical-resistant aprons).
  • First Aid / Statement of Practical Treatment: Outlines immediate life-saving medical countermeasures organized by exposure route:
    • If Swallowed: Indication whether to induce vomiting or administer fluids (vomiting is strictly contraindicated if the product contains petroleum distillates due to chemical pneumonia risks).
    • If in Eyes: Hold eye open and rinse gently with water for 15 to 20 minutes; remove contact lenses after the first 5 minutes, then continue rinsing.
    • If on Skin: Remove contaminated clothing immediately and flush skin with plenty of water for 15 to 20 minutes.
    • Note to Physician: Specific toxicological guidance, including emergency antidotes such as atropine sulfate or pralidoxime (2-PAM) for organophosphate and carbamate cholinesterase inhibition.

Environmental, Physical, and Chemical Hazards

  • Environmental Hazards: Highlights ecological vulnerabilities, such as extreme toxicity to fish, aquatic invertebrates, or birds. Labels carrying groundwater advisory warnings alert applicators that the chemical possesses physical properties that facilitate leaching through permeable soils, particularly in karst terrain with sinkholes.
  • Pollinator Protection Statements: Formulations highly toxic to bees display the EPA Bee Hazard Icon and mandatory restrictions barring application while crops or flowering weeds are in bloom and foraging pollinators are active.
  • Physical and Chemical Hazards: Discloses chemical combustion risks, including flash points (e.g., "Combustible. Do not store or use near heat or open flame") or chemical incompatibility (e.g., "Do not mix with oxidizing agents or chlorine bleach").

Directions for Use, Agricultural Standards, and Critical Intervals

The Directions for Use section contains the operational roadmap for chemical deployment:

  • Agricultural Use Requirements Box: References compliance with the federal Worker Protection Standard (WPS, 40 CFR Part 170), governing agricultural workers and pesticide handlers on farms, forests, nurseries, and greenhouses.
  • Restricted-Entry Interval (REI): The mandatory time period that must elapse after a pesticide application before agricultural workers may enter the treated area without wearing specialized chemical-resistant PPE. Standard REIs range from 12 hours to 48 hours (and up to 72 hours in arid zones for certain organophosphates).
  • Pre-Harvest Interval (PHI): The minimum legal number of calendar days that must elapse between the last pesticide application and the harvesting of an agricultural crop (e.g., "Do not apply within 21 days of harvest"). The PHI guarantees that chemical residues degrade naturally to concentrations below federal legal food tolerance limits established by the EPA.

Mandatory vs. Advisory Label Statements

Distinguishing between mandatory and advisory language is critical for legal compliance and exam success.

[!IMPORTANT] Enforceability Rules:

  • Mandatory Statements: Legally binding commands that direct the applicator to take or avoid specific actions. They employ imperative verbs such as "shall", "must", "do not", "apply at a rate of", or "users are required to". Violating a mandatory statement is a direct federal and state violation.
  • Advisory Statements: Informational recommendations or best management practices that employ permissive language such as "should", "may", "it is recommended that", or "consider". These provide technical guidance to optimize chemical efficacy or reduce non-target drift, but do not establish legal prohibitions.

Comparison: Mandatory vs. Advisory Statements

Statement TypeTypical Verbs UsedExample Label PhrasingLegal Enforceability
MandatoryMust, Shall, Do Not, Always"Do not apply within 100 feet of any sinkhole or surface water."Legally Enforceable; failure to comply is a violation of law
MandatoryRequire, Only, Prohibited"Handlers must wear chemical-resistant gloves made of nitrile rubber."Legally Enforceable; operating without PPE violates FIFRA
AdvisoryShould, May, Recommended"Applications should be made using nozzles that deliver coarse droplets."Technical recommendation; non-compliance is not an automatic violation
AdvisoryConsider, It is suggested"Consider rotating modes of action to manage weed resistance."Best management practice guidance
